About
Providence North Everett Cardiology
Whether you need ongoing care for a chronic issue or a minimally invasive procedure, Providence is here for you. We’ll provide compassionate, personal care to help you live your fullest life.Our team – made up of board certified cardiologists, physician assistants and nurse practitioners – takes time to learn about you and listen to your concerns. Then we work together to create a personalized treatment plan for you and your heart.We treat a wide range of cardiac conditions, including irregular heart rhythms, including atrial fibrillation; angina/chest pain; valve disorders; stenosis; and cardiovascular disease.
